AeroTurbine Inc, a wholly-owned subsidiary of International Lease Finance Corporation (ILFC), has relocated its UK-based sales team to a new office in Farnborough Business Park, Hampshire.
This move will provide an expanded space to accommodate staff growth and enable AeroTurbine to continue maintaining close contact with its customers in the European, Middle Eastern and African regions.
Michael King, AeroTurbine president and chief executive officer, commented: "The European, Middle Eastern and African markets are vital to AeroTurbine's success. This expansion will allow our growing staff to continue to provide world-class service to our customers."
